Minimally Invasive Correction of PIP Flexion Contractures

PIP flexion contractures can present as a consequence of various factors, including injury, inflammation, and scarring. These contractures impair finger extension, leading functional limitations. Fortunately, there are numerous non-invasive techniques available to treat these contractures and improve hand function. These approaches often include physical therapy, splinting, and injections. Physical therapy can help in lengthening the affected tendons and ligaments, while splinting provides sustained traction to gradually improve the contracture. Injections of corticosteroids or hyaluronic acid can alleviate inflammation and enhance tissue healing.
